Enhanced Security

One of the most significant benefits of the cloud for government agencies is the enhanced security it provides. Cloud service providers invest heavily in advanced security measures to protect sensitive data. These measures include:

  • Encryption: Data is encrypted both in transit and at rest, ensuring that it remains secure from unauthorized access.
  • Access Control: Fine-grained access controls and identity management systems help ensure that only authorized personnel can access sensitive information.
  • Regular Security Audits: Cloud providers conduct regular security audits and compliance checks to identify and mitigate potential vulnerabilities.

Cost Savings

The cloud for government agencies offers substantial cost savings compared to traditional on-premises infrastructure. Key cost-saving benefits include:

  • Reduced Capital Expenditure: Moving to the cloud eliminates the need for significant upfront investments in hardware and infrastructure.
  • Operational Efficiency: Cloud services are billed on a pay-as-you-go basis, allowing agencies to scale resources up or down based on demand, thus optimizing costs.
  • Maintenance Savings: Cloud providers handle all maintenance and updates, freeing up government IT staff to focus on more strategic initiatives.

Operational Efficiency

The cloud for government agencies significantly enhances operational efficiency by providing:

  • Scalability: Agencies can quickly scale their resources to meet changing demands without the need for extensive planning and procurement.
  • Collaboration: Cloud-based tools facilitate better collaboration among government employees, enabling real-time document sharing and communication.
  • Disaster Recovery: Cloud services offer robust disaster recovery solutions, ensuring data is always available and can be quickly restored in case of any disruptions.

Real-World Examples

Several government agencies have successfully implemented cloud solutions to improve their operations. For example:

  • U.S. Department of Defense: The department has transitioned to a cloud-first strategy, leveraging cloud services to enhance mission readiness and operational efficiency.
  • U.K. National Health Service (NHS): The NHS has adopted cloud solutions to improve patient care and streamline administrative processes.
  • Australian Government: The Australian government has implemented cloud services to improve data management, enhance cybersecurity, and reduce costs.
